Written question asked by Baroness Goudie (Labour), in the House of Lords. It was answered by Lord McNally (Liberal Democrat) on Thursday, 27 October 2011.
Justice: Class Action Lawsuits
- Question
- To ask Her Majesty’s Government when they will publish their consultation on class action lawsuits.
- Answer
-
The UK Government do not intend to consult on a generic right to bring class actions and do not support the introduction of such a right at UK or EU level. The Government have indicated they would consider collective redress mechanisms in specific sectors such as competition, but will decide when and whether to consult on such proposals following a robust assessment of need.
